Biography

Mostafa Atri is a specialist in Medical Imaging with a focus on Abdominal Imaging. He holds an MBBS degree and is currently a professor at the University of Toronto, affiliated with the Toronto General Hospital, known for his contributions to the field of medical imaging. His expertise lies in various imaging techniques and their application in diagnosing abdominal disorders. Professor Atri is actively involved in education and research, mentoring students and publishing in scientific journals. His academic work is aimed at improving patient outcomes through advanced imaging technologies and methodologies. He has a commitment to integrating clinical practice with academic research, and he collaborates with other professionals in the medical field to foster innovation in diagnostic imaging techniques.
